Set Small, Achievable Goals:

 

When it comes to building confidence, starting small can make all the difference. It’s easy to feel overwhelmed when you have big goals in mind, but breaking them down into smaller, more manageable tasks can help you stay motivated and make progress. For example, you could begin by organizing your workspace or completing a 10-minute workout each day. These may seem like simple tasks, but they can help you build momentum and gain a sense of accomplishment.

 

The key to making progress is to celebrate these small victories. Recognize and acknowledge your achievements, no matter how small they may seem. By doing this, you’ll build confidence and be more motivated to tackle bigger challenges. Remember, Rome wasn’t built in a day, and neither are our goals. It takes time and effort, but with perseverance and a positive attitude, you can achieve anything you set your mind to.

Physical Exercise:

Engaging in regular exercise is not only essential for maintaining physical fitness but it also plays a crucial role in boosting your self-confidence. When you exercise, your body releases endorphins, which are natural chemicals that create feelings of happiness and euphoria, leaving you feeling refreshed, energized, and motivated. It’s not necessary to start with intense workouts; even simple activities like walking or practicing yoga can have a significant impact on your overall well-being.

Practice Public Speaking:

Public speaking is a common fear, but it’s also a powerful way to build confidence. Start small by speaking up in meetings or joining a group like Toastmasters. Each time you speak, you step out of your comfort zone and build confidence.

 

Mindfulness and Meditation:

A lack of confidence often stems from overthinking and worrying about the future. Mindfulness brings you back to the present, helping you focus on the now, not the what-ifs.

Volunteer Work:

Helping others can have a profound impact on one’s personal growth and development. When we do something selfless for others, we feel a sense of accomplishment and our self-esteem gets a boost. It gives us a sense of purpose and fulfillment, making us feel more connected to the world around us. In addition to the psychological benefits, helping others also has practical advantages. It can help us build new skills, make new friends, and expand our network. There are many ways to get involved in community service, such as volunteering at a local shelter, donating to a charity, or simply offering a listening ear to someone in need. By taking advantage of these opportunities, we can make a positive impact on the world and in turn, improve our own lives.
